Disability shower installation services involve customizing or modifying shower areas to improve accessibility and safety for individ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include the installation of low-threshold or walk-in showers,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and accessible controls. The goal is to create a b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ips and falls while providing ease of use for people with limited mobility. Skilled contractors ensure that the layout and fixtures meet the specific needs of each individual, promoting independence and comfort in the bathroom space.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with mobility issues, such as difficulty stepping over high tub edges or maneuvering in confined spaces. It helps prevent accidents and injuries that can occur during bathing activities. Additionally, disability shower installations can alleviate the need for assistance, offering a more private and dignified bathing experience. These modifications are especially beneficial for seniors, those recovering from injuries, or individuals living with chronic conditions that impact mobility.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while custom features can increase the price.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on individual needs.

Material Expenses - Materials for disability showers can vary from $300 to $2,000, with options including accessible tiles, grab bars, and low-threshold bases. Higher-end finishes and specialized fixtures tend to raise overall costs. Contact local service providers for detailed material cost estimates.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for installing a disability shower typically fall between $800 and $2,500, influenced by the project's scope and site conditions. More complex installations may require additional labor hours, impacting overall pricing. Local contractors can offer tailored quotes for specific projects.

Additional Charges - Extra costs such as permits, structural modifications, or custom features can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These charges vary based on the home's existing setup and local regulations. Consulting with local pros can help identify potential additional exp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
